The CarePlace for Douglas County Residents exists for those patients who do not have private health insurance and cannot afford to pay for healthcare in the private sector. Endeavoring to treat the whole patient, The CarePlace provides medical care, health education, and select social services to all of its patients who meet our requirements. The CarePlace is staffed by volunteers and medical services are provided at no cost to those who qualify.
The CarePlace was birthed out of an expressed need by hundreds of people who used The Pantry. It was heard repeatedly, “It was a choice this week to either feed my family or go to the doctor.” The catalyst for this free medical clinic came in the donation of a 7,500 square foot mortgage free medical building. God has blessed The CarePlace with partnerships with Wellstar Douglas and Kaiser Permanente and volunteers of licensed medical professionals and many others.
